Frequently Asked Questions about Southaven at Magnolia Lane
What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in the Southaven at Magnolia Lane area of Anaheim, CA?
As of today, August 22, 2026, there are currently 127 available Southaven at Magnolia Lane apartments priced from $1,450 to $3,221, with an average monthly rent of $2,401.
How much are Studio apartments in Southaven at Magnolia Lane?
There are currently 24 Studio Apartments in Southaven at Magnolia Lane with rent ranges from $1,450 to $1,932 with an average price of $1,723.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Southaven at Magnolia Lane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Southaven at Magnolia Lane ranges from $1,680 to $2,550 with an average monthly rent of $2,156.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Southaven at Magnolia Lane c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Southaven at Magnolia Lane range from $1,995 to $3,221.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,588.
